8 (1 point) Match the description of each process with its name. Question 8 options: When a grand jury issues a formal charge, stating that there is enough evidence that a defendant committed a crime to justify having a trial. This process includes getting basic information from a suspect such as address and birth date, fingerprints, photographs, and sometimes blood/DNA. This is the questioning of a suspect or witness by law enforcement authorities. When someone is taken into custody and charged with a crime. A criminal defendant is brought into court, told of the charges against him or her, and asked to plead guilty or not guilty. 1. booking 2. arraignment 3. arrest 4. indictment 5. interrogation
